Famous for authentic boiled and baked bagels, Bruegger's bakers lend their expertise to crafting a variety of other stone-hearth baked breads, such as Ciabatta and the exclusive Softwich™, a softer, square bagel ideal for sandwiches. In neighborhoods around the country, Bruegger's bakeries offer a warm, comfortable setting for guests to enjoy a wholesome meal with family and friends. Franchising Tips and Facts
Be sure to ask about marketing programs (if any) that are offered to Bruegger's Franchisees. If your franchise contract requires you to make contributions for larger scale advertising and marketing programs, try to find out how the franchisees participate in decisions on the programs, campaigns and budget management. You want to make sure your money is going to good use, and it's being managed properly.
How much can you make if you own a Bruegger's Franchise? By law a franchise salesperson cannot provide you with an Earnings Claim, unless it is included in the disclosure document. There is no legal requirement that the franchisor must provide you with an Earnings Claim, however some franchisors do provide it. If the franchisor has chosen not to provide it, then it remains important to contact other franchisees listed in the disclosure document. Other Bruegger's franchisees can answer many of your questions. Many franchisors will also require you to visit their headquarters before signing the agreement, so that you can both get to know each other better. This is known as Discovery Day.
Franchising opportunities provide brand recognition, management and administrative systems, and a proven business model to small business owners. In theory, this should result in Bruegger's franchises having higher success rates than non-franchise business opportunities. But in practice, franchises can and do fail.
Sometimes, franchises fail because the franchise buyers do not adequately research franchise opportunities prior to purchase. If you are interested in a Bruegger's Franchise Opportunity, then you should do your homework. Try to match your personal attributes and interests to activities associated with the business opportunity you are interested in. If your personality and interests, don't match, you may want to consider a different franchise.
Ultimately the success of owning a Bruegger's Franchise can be determined by such factors as your franchise territory, site location, and your individual efforts and commitment to following the system. While you will be your own boss, when owning a Bruegger's franchise you will not be "on your own". The franchisor will have also committed to fulfill their promises to you as stated in the franchise agreement.
